FIA Addresses Max Verstappen’s Post-Race Remarks Following the Abu Dhabi Grand Prix

Max Verstappen’s dominant performance in the 2024 Formula 1 season, culminating in his fourth consecutive World Championship title, was marred by a controversial incident at the Abu Dhabi Grand Prix. His on-track clash with McLaren’s Oscar Piastri on the first lap resulted in a 10-second penalty for Verstappen, a decision he vehemently contested over team radio, using derogatory language directed at the race stewards. While the FIA chose not to impose further penalties for the outburst, the incident highlighted Verstappen’s occasionally volatile temperament and sparked debate about the appropriate standards of conduct for a world champion.

The collision itself was a racing incident, albeit one where Verstappen’s aggressive overtaking maneuver on the inside of Turn 1 resulted in contact with Piastri’s car. Both drivers spun, losing valuable positions early in the race. While first-lap incidents often receive some leniency from stewards, acknowledging the heightened possibility of contact in the initial scramble for position, the stewards deemed Verstappen sufficiently at fault to warrant the penalty. Piastri also faced penalties during the race, including a separate 10-second penalty for a collision with Franco Colapinto, compounding McLaren’s challenging weekend.

Verstappen’s frustration boiled over in the immediate aftermath of the incident, expressing his displeasure with the penalty through an expletive-laden radio message to his team. While the FIA opted to close the matter without further repercussions, the incident drew attention to Verstappen’s history of using inappropriate language, particularly following a similar incident at the Singapore Grand Prix earlier in the season. For that infraction, Verstappen was assigned community service, a unique penalty designed to contribute positively while addressing his conduct.

The community service, which took place in conjunction with the FIA awards ceremony in Kigali, Rwanda, involved Verstappen working with young aspiring racers as part of the Rwanda Automobile Club’s grassroots development program. This program utilizes the FIA Affordable Cross Car, assembled locally in Rwanda, promoting motorsport accessibility on a global scale. The FIA’s commitment to motorsport development, through its network of National Sporting Authorities, aims to broaden participation and nurture talent in emerging motorsport markets. Verstappen’s involvement, while stemming from a disciplinary measure, served to highlight this important initiative.

The FIA Awards ceremony in Kigali provided a symbolic backdrop for both Verstappen’s achievements and his recent disciplinary action. Receiving his fourth consecutive World Championship trophy, a remarkable feat solidifying his status as one of the sport’s dominant forces, Verstappen’s presence also underscored the importance of sportsmanship and respectful conduct within the high-pressure environment of Formula 1. The ceremony also recognized Lando Norris and Charles Leclerc, who finished second and third respectively in the drivers’ championship, highlighting the intense competition Verstappen faced throughout the season.

The final driver standings reflect Verstappen’s commanding lead, finishing the season with 437 points, a substantial margin ahead of Norris with 374 points and Leclerc with 356. While Verstappen’s season was marked by success, it also underscored the ongoing debate around driver behavior and the responsibility that comes with being a champion. The Abu Dhabi incident, and the subsequent community service, served as a reminder that on-track performance must be balanced with respect for the rules, officials, and fellow competitors. The incident, though ultimately closed, added another layer of complexity to Verstappen’s already multifaceted legacy in the sport.
